The anti-Stokes/Stokes ratios for living Chlorella pyrenoidosa cells at 294 K considerably exceed those given by the thermal population factor [n/(n+1)]. We have shown that resonance enhancement in the scattered photon is mainly responsible for this, but cannot rule out that some population enhancement occurs. © 1978.
